在ClosedXML中对表进行排序是通过使用Sort方法来实现的。Sort方法可以按照指定的列进行升序或降序排序。
具体步骤如下:
using (var workbook = new XLWorkbook("path_to_excel_file"))
{
var worksheet = workbook.Worksheet("sheet_name");
// 接下来的代码将在这里编写
}
var range = worksheet.Range("A1:D10"); // 选择A1到D10的范围
range.Sort("B", XLSortOrder.Ascending); // 按照B列进行升序排序
在上述代码中,"B"表示要排序的列,XLSortOrder.Ascending表示升序排序。如果要进行降序排序,可以使用XLSortOrder.Descending。
range.SortBy("B", XLSortOrder.Ascending, "C", XLSortOrder.Descending); // 先按照B列升序排序,再按照C列降序排序
workbook.Save();
这样,就完成了在ClosedXML中对表进行排序的操作。
ClosedXML是一个开源的.NET库,用于操作Excel文件。它提供了简单易用的API,可以方便地读取、创建和修改Excel文件。ClosedXML支持多种功能,包括数据排序、筛选、图表生成等。它是一个强大的工具,适用于各种Excel处理需求。
腾讯云提供了云计算相关的产品和服务,其中包括云服务器、云数据库、云存储等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务信息。
领取专属 10元无门槛券
手把手带您无忧上云